Prayer: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for issuance of Writ of Mandamus, directing the 3rd respondent herein to consider the representation of the petitioner dated 23.03.2023. ORDER

This writ petition has been filed directing the 3rd respondent herein to consider the representation of the petitioner dated 23.03.2023. 2.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Government Advocate appearing on behalf of the official respondents. 3.This petition is not maintainable, in view of the Order passed by a Division Bench of this Court in G.Prabhakaran v. The Superintendent of Police, Thanjavur reported in (2018) 2 LW Crl 489. The Hon'ble Supreme Court in its latest judgment rendered by a three Judge Bench in M. Subramaniam v. S. Janaki reported in (2020) 5 CTC 464, after relying upon Sakiri Vasu Case, has categorically held that the High Court cannot issue any direction for registration of FIR in exercise of its jurisdiction under Section 482 of Cr.P.C.

The Hon'ble Supreme Court held that the informant has to necessarily avail of the alternative remedy provided under Section 154 (3) of Cr.P.C., and Section 156 (3) of Cr.P.C. Liberty is given to the petitioner to workout his remedy as per the directions issued by the Division Bench in the order referred supra.

This Writ Petition is disposed of accordingly. No Costs. 27.07.2023 Index : Yes/No Internet : Yes/No ssr To 1.The District Collector, Vellore District.
